Calling it a historic and momentous day for humankind, the United Nations Secretary General has welcomed the entering into force of the landmark Paris Climate Change Agreement. The accord reached its ratification threshold of 55 countries representing at least 55% of global emission in early October - a record time period that has now seen close to 100 countries, including South Africa, ratify the agreement through national processes. The agreement that includes ratifications by the world's largest emitters, China and the United States, now requires an obligation of nations to keep global warming below two degrees Celsius above pre-industrial levels.
